帮我写一个php查询数据库信息的代码
时间: 2023-03-29 14:01:32 浏览: 50
好的,以下是一个简单的 PHP 查询数据库信息的代码:
<?php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database_name");
// 检查连接是否成功
if (!$conn) {
die("连接失败: " . mysqli_connect_error());
}
// 查询数据库
$sql = "SELECT * FROM table_name";
$result = mysqli_query($conn, $sql);
// 输出查询结果
if (mysqli_num_rows($result) > ) {
while($row = mysqli_fetch_assoc($result)) {
echo "id: " . $row["id"]. " - Name: " . $row["name"]. " - Email: " . $row["email"]. "<br>";
}
} else {
echo " 结果";
}
// 关闭连接
mysqli_close($conn);
?>
相关问题
帮我用php写个数据库查询 pdo
好的,我可以回答这个问题。以下是一个使用 PDO 进行数据库查询的 PHP 代码示例:
<?php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"myDBPDO";
try {
$con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
// 设置 PDO 错误模式为异常
$con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
// 使用 PDO 进行查询
$stmt = $conn->prepare("SELECT * FROM MyGuests");
$stmt->execute();
// 设置结果集为关联数组
$result = $stmt->setFetchMode(PDO::FETCH_ASSOC);
// 输出查询结果
foreach($stmt->fetchAll() as $k=>$v) {
echo "id: " . $v["id"] . " - Name: " . $v["firstname"] . " " . $v["lastname"] . "<br>";
}
} catch(PDOException $e) {
echo "Error: " . $e->getMessage();
}
$conn = null;
?>
希望这个示例对你有所帮助!
用PHP写一个连接数据库的代码
可以使用 PHP 内置的 PDO(PHP Data Objects)类来连接数据库,以下是一个简单的连接 MySQL 数据库的代码示例:
```php
// 数据库连接信息
$host = 'localhost';
$dbname = 'mydatabase';
$username = 'myusername';
$password = 'mypassword';
// 创建数据库连接
try {
$pdo = new PDO("mysql:host=$host;dbname=$dbname", $username, $password);
$p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
echo "Connected successfully";
} catch(PDOException $e) {
echo "Connection failed: " . $e->getMessage();
}
```
在上面的代码中,我们首先定义了数据库连接信息,然后使用 `PDO` 类创建了一个数据库连接。如果连接成功,将会输出 "Connected successfully",否则输出错误信息。
你需要将 `$host`、`$dbname`、`$username` 和 `$password` 替换成你自己的数据库连接信息。